How correlated are CCJ and FLR?

Over the past 3 years, CCJ and FLR moved with a correlation of 0.55, which is moderate. Little has changed lately, as the 1-year reading of 0.50 lands near the 3-year figure. Over 5 years the correlation is 0.48, and the annualized covariance of weekly returns is 995.6 %².

By 3-year correlation, FLR places #10 of the 15 assets tracked against CCJ. The trailing year gives CCJ the advantage: +41.5% versus +31.6%, a 9.9-point spread.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.55 mean?

On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.55 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
